Analysis of bashunit

Overall verdict

  • bashunit is a solid, lightweight testing framework for Bash scripts that fills a real gap in the shell-scripting ecosystem, offering a simple and familiar unit-testing experience without heavy dependencies.

Why this product is good

  • Pure Bash implementation with minimal dependencies, making it easy to install and run in almost any environment including CI pipelines
  • Familiar xUnit-style syntax (assertions, test functions) that lowers the learning curve for developers coming from other testing frameworks
  • Provides useful features like mocking, spies, and helper assertions tailored specifically for shell script testing
  • Actively maintained with clear documentation and examples on its official site
  • Fast execution since it avoids heavyweight runtime dependencies
  • Encourages better testing practices and code quality for Bash scripts, which are often left untested
